the size of the pulley bearings are

6406 and 6210

the size of the seal is 64 x 90 x 13mm don't know sizes in inch


i think you can get the bearing and seal at a local bearing/ seal shop

here is picture of the pignions the slow one has 8 teeth on the pignion 35/8 = 4,375 = ( 4,4 ratio) the fast one has 10 teeth on the pignion 35/10= 3.5 = ( 3,5 ratio) ( both the diff's got 35 teeth on the crownwheel ) http://i1232.photobucket.com/albums/ff364/fomoco60/DSC01611_zpsf7498b8c.jpg http:/...
